Oh and it's not "borrows heavily" it literally is judo but branched out in a different direction. One of Kano's students, Maeda was traveling the world to promote kano jujutsu (which was later renamed judo) and taught the huehues. They then integrated jajajaja-do folk wrestling techniques.

I couldn't find any judo in west tokyo. My coach told me budo is dying in Japan. Kendo is on the decline as is judo and karate. He reckons it's a combination of nihonjin constantly getting their shit pushed in by gaijin in their own styles and the massive promotion of soccer and baseball.
